Testing in More Than One Patient

Information for Healthcare
Professionals
Only healthcare professionals are allowed to
perform blood glucose tests on more than
one patient using the same
Accu-Chek Active meter.
Always adhere to the recognized procedures
for handling objects that are potentially
contaminated with human material. Follow
the hygiene and safety policy of your
laboratory or institution.
WARNING
W
• Any patient with an infection or
suffering from an infectious disease
and any patient who is a carrier of a
multi-resistant microorganism must
be assigned his/her own meter. This
also applies if it is suspected that a
patient has one of the above. During
this time the meter must not be used
to test any other patient.
• Patients and healthcare professionals
are potentially at risk of becoming
infected if the same Accu-Chek Active
meter is used to test blood glucose in
more than one patient. Any object
coming into contact with human blood is
a potential source of infection.
• Residues of water or disinfectant on the
skin can dilute the blood drop and thus
produce incorrect test results.
• Dispose of used lancets or single-use
lancing devices and used test strips
according to the hygiene and safety
policy of your laboratory or institution.
• Wear protective gloves.
• The patients' hands should be washed
with soap and warm water and dried
thoroughly.
• Use only a lancing device approved for
use by healthcare professionals. Follow
the handling instructions in the
instructions for use of the lancing device.
• Apply blood to the test strip while it is
outside the meter.
Disinfecting the Meter
The following parts of the meter may
become contaminated:
• the surface
• the cover
• the measurement window
The meter, the cover, and the measurement
window must be carefully cleaned and
disinfected after every use. Remember to
also clean recesses, grooves, and gaps.
Cotton swabs, pads, or cloths which are
lightly moistened with 70 % isopropanol are
suitable for disinfecting.
1
2
H
• Do not spray anything onto the meter
and do not immerse it in liquid.
• Do not allow liquid to enter any openings
in the meter.

Wipe the meter
surface using a cloth
lightly moistened
with 70 %
isopropanol.
Carefully dab the
measurement
window and its
surrounding area as
well as the cover
from both sides using
a lightly moistened
cloth or cotton swab.
